How they compare
France currently reports 51.8% against 51.5% in Lithuania, a difference of 0.3%.
The two have swapped places 3 times across 6 shared years of data; in 2017 it was Lithuania ahead.
France ranks 51st and Lithuania ranks 52nd of 69 countries.
France has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.
